1998 Silverado knocking on startup

Asked by Karterblaze Dec 02, 2017 at 09:58 AM about the 1998 Chevrolet C/K 1500 Silverado Extended Cab RWD

Question type: Maintenance & Repair

My 1998 Silverado 350 5.7L is knocking maybe
3sec on start up everytime unless the truck has
been parked for hours. Go to the store park come
back crank up, knocking again (at the most 3sec).
Stop to get gas, finish, crank up and knocking
again. The truck had 240k miles, but is very very
dependable. I can literally go any place that has
roads to it. I’m now using 10/30 penzoil. What is the
cause if this knock? which is getting louder

It’s possible the bearings have some slop going on. Had similar issues in my 96 a few years back. Noticed when I was changing the pan gasket that the crank was actually sliding back and forth on the journal and the bottom of the piston rod was actually smacking against the crank lobe. It only did it during start up like you described. Probly time to look into a freshen up or overhaul. Motor had close to 200k mikes at the time. Overhauled mine. Motor now has over 330k miles and still sting as ever
